Aggressive behaviour is a type of behaviour which is widespread in the animal kingdom. Animals display this behaviour by expressing it in the form of anger and violence.  

Animals use this behaviour mostly to establish its dominant nature in front of the opponent in the competition. This allows animals to either kill an animal in a fight (violence) or establish territorial boundaries and some species compete to mate with the female individual.
